🍫 Not all dark chocolate is created equal — even the "healthy" kind can be a trap. When cocoa is processed with alkali (called Dutch processing), it removes a lot of the flavonols that actually make it beneficial.

Flavonols affect the interrelated glucosinolate and camalexin biosynthetic pathways in Arabidopsis thaliana A combined transcriptomic and metabolomic analysis of Arabidopsis fls1 and tt7 mutants revealed negative effects of flavonols on camalexin accumulation and

Tyrosine-sulfated peptide hormone induces flavonol biosynthesis to control elongation and differentiation in Arabidopsis primary root bioRxiv - the preprint server for biology, operated by Cold Spring Harbor Laboratory, a research and educational institution

Study reveals that the PSY1 hormone in #Arabidopsis promotes root growth by inducing flavonol biosynthesis. This discovery highlights the critical role of #flavonols in regulating root elongation and differentiation.
